| | | Notes: 1) All height, width and depth dimensions are shown in inches. 2) Water line must provide 15-100 psi water pressure. Rough in water line before installing refrigerator. 3) Floor must support refrigerator (more than 600 pounds), contents and modern door modern panels. 4) The built-in refrigerator can be installed recessed in the cabinet opening or at the end of architectural cabinets using a side panel to enclose the refrigerator side. *Leg levelers extend 1/8" below rollers; add 11/8" for levelers fully extended 11/4" below rollers. **Please refer to Installation instructions manual prior to installation. Installation instructions are also available at www.thermador.com. ***If a recommended water line location is used, no additional plumbing needs to be purchased. +If solid soffit is not available, see anti-tip requirements in installation instructions manual. One of the three methods outlined in the installation instructions must be used. Specifications are correct at time of printing.
